CEO gender and corporate cash holdings. Are female CEOs more conservative?
Asia-Pacific Journal of Accounting & Economics, 2015In this paper, we empirically investigate how CEO gender affects corporate cash holdings and the over-investment of free cash flow among Chinese listed firms. Thereby, we utilize a sample of 468 listed firms with female CEOs and a matched sample of firms with male CEOs during 2007–2011.

CEO Gender and Acquisition Targeting
We examine whether CEO gender shapes acquisition targeting in the market for corporate control. Using a panel of S&P 1,500 firms, we find that firms led by female CEOs are approximately 2 percentage points (roughly 40% relative to the base rate) more likely to become acquisition targets.Kamyar Goudarzi +3 more
